For Madison homebuyers, there are specific regional programs that a knowledgeable local lender can help you access. The Mississippi Home Corporation (MHC) offers several valuable programs, including the MCC Tax Credit, which provides a federal tax credit to help with your annual mortgage interest, and the HFA Preferred Loan with competitive interest rates for first-time and repeat buyers. A lender familiar with these programs can tell you if you qualify and seamlessly integrate them into your financing, potentially saving you thousands over the life of your loan.
Your actionable strategy should start with a three-pronged approach. First, get pre-approved, not just pre-qualified. In Madison's market, sellers expect a robust pre-approval letter from a reputable lender. This step is non-negotiable. Second, interview at least three local lenders. Ask pointed questions: "How often do you work with buyers in Madison?" "Can you provide references from recent local clients?" "What is your average time to close, and how will you communicate with me and my real estate agent?" Finally, compare Loan Estimates carefully. Look at the interest rate, annual percentage rate (APR), and closing costs. Remember, the lowest rate might come with higher fees or poor service that could jeopardize your closing.
